Here is something similar to what you have in your example (and
compared to your LaTeX code, I find the ConTeXt way of coding this
wonderfully simple and elegant):
\startsetups[header]
\framed[width=\textwidth,frame=off,bottomframe=on,align=right]
{\rlap{\headnumber[chapter] \getmarking[chapter]}
\hfill
\pagenumber
\hfill
\llap{\externalfigure[cow][height=1cm]}}
\stopsetups
\startsetups[footer]
\framed[width=\textwidth,frame=off,topframe=on,align=center]
{{\bf Copyright 2009, My Company} \\ Blablabla}
\stopsetups
\setupheadertexts[\setups{header}]
\setupfootertexts[\setups{footer}]
\starttext
\chapter{One}
Hello World
\stoptext
The main reference is the file http://www.pragma-ade.com/general/manuals/cont-eni.pdf
, you want to read the sections on headers and footers and on
framing (\framed is one of the most powerful and versatile commands in
ConTeXt).
